Understanding FUE Hair Transplant

FUE hair transplant is a minimally invasive procedure that involves extracting individual hair follicles from a donor area and implanting them into areas experiencing hair loss or thinning. This technique is considered highly advanced and provides natural-looking results. Unlike traditional hair transplant methods, FUE does not leave behind a linear scar, making it an appealing option for many individuals.

The Benefits of FUE Hair Transplant

Natural Results

FUE hair transplant ensures natural-looking results as the transplanted hair blends seamlessly with your existing hair. The procedure takes into account factors such as hairline design and the angle and direction of hair growth, creating a natural appearance.

Minimally Invasive

It is a minimally invasive procedure that does not require any major incisions or sutures. This leads to a faster recovery time compared to traditional hair transplant methods.

No Visible Scarring

Unlike older methods, FUE hair transplant does not leave behind a noticeable linear scar. Instead, tiny dot-like scars are scattered in the donor area, which is virtually undetectable once the hair grows back.

Versatility

FUE hair transplant can be us ed to address various types of hair loss, including receding hairline, thinning crown, and even eyebrow or beard restoration. The versatility of this procedure makes it a suitable option for both men and women.

The FUE Hair Transplant Process

Initial Consultation

The first step in the FUE hair transplant process is an initial consultation with a qualified hair transplant surgeon. During this consultation, the surgeon will evaluate your hair loss pattern, donor area quality, and discuss your expectations and goals.

Donor Area Preparation

Before the procedure, the donor area, typically the back or sides of the head, is trimmed to facilitate the extraction of hair follicles. This area is chosen because the hair in this region is genetically resistant to balding.

Follicular Unit Extraction

The FUE procedure involves extracting individual hair follicles from the donor area using a specialized instrument. This process is meticulous and requires skill and precision to ensure the viability of the extracted follicles.

Recipient Area Creation

Once the donor follicles are extracted, the surgeon creates tiny incisions in the recipient area where the hair will be transplanted. The angle, depth, and direction of these incisions are crucial to achieve natural hair growth.

Graft Implantation

The extracted hair follicles are then carefully implanted into the recipient area using fine needles or micro blades. The surgeon strategically places the follicles to achieve a natural hairline and density.

Post-Transplant Care

After the procedure, your surgeon will provide instructions on how to care for your transplanted hair and manage the healing process. It is essential to follow these guidelines to ensure optimal results.
